The lady who released a song where she “moo’d” for half of it, yes you read that right, Doja Cat (Amala Zandile Dlamini) is a R&B/Pop star rising to fame, however she is by no means new to the music scene. Signing to a label in 2014, Doja Cat has been releasing music for years. Doja is of South African and Jewish decent, and because of this her music has a distinct style that really cant be /replicated/.
Doja Cat has taken the internet by storm these past two years, especially Tik Tok. She is know for her playful, yet energetic music. Her music is, empowerment. When it comes to music technicality, Doja likes to play with her style. She has a distinct voice but is able to be a loud angry rapper and a soft angelic singer at the same time. She likes to play with fast and slow rhythms, which really are the template for styles in music, and for this reason it so is difficult to say what her music really is. When it comes to instruments it’s all about the lo-fi feels, dreamy guitar, a snare beat, and lots of back vocals. Her music is breathy, powerful, and soft all at the same time. Sometimes her lyrics can be a bit pointless, like the cow song, but other times it’s a love song with heartfelt lyrics like “Say So”. - Say So (Hot Pink)- THE Tik Tok song, this song has a very soft feel. It really feels like you immersed yourself into a dream. With its catchy guitar and background vocals, it’s hard not to love this song.
- MOOO! (Amala)- This song is comical, but also has its own innuendos. It turns a childhood song into a song of female empowerment. Doja Cat manages to make a song about farms and cows, sexy?
- Boss B*tch (Birds Of Prey)- This song is exactly what the title of the song says it is. Her singing in this is much more intense, the scream rappy type. The song is fast paced and is perfect for any work out playlist.
